Ingredients and Preparation
Essential Ingredients and Possible Substitutions
To recreate this delightful soup, gather the following ingredients:
| Ingredient | Amount | Possible Substitutions |
|—————————|—————–|————————————-|
| Celeriac | 1 large | Parsnip, potato |
| Unsalted butter | 6 tablespoons | Olive oil (for a dairy-free option) |
| Onion | 1 medium | Shallots |
| Garlic | 3 cloves | Dried garlic (to taste) |
| Vegetable broth | 4 cups | Chicken broth |
| Heavy cream | 1 cup | Coconut cream (for vegan option) |
| Kale | 2 cups | Spinach (for a softer texture) |
| Salt and pepper | To taste | Herbs like thyme or rosemary |
Step-by-Step Recipe Instructions with Tips
Let’s dive into creating this luscious soup:
-
Prep the Ingredients: Start by washing and peeling your celeriac, then chop it into small cubes. Dice the onion and mince the garlic.
-
Sauté the Aromatics: In a large pot, melt the unsalted butter over medium heat. Allow it to brown slightly, letting the nutty aroma fill your kitchen. Stir in the onion and cook until it’s translucent, followed by the garlic for an additional minute.
-
Add Celeriac and Broth: Toss in the celeriac cubes and pour in the vegetable broth. Bring the mixture to a gentle boil, then reduce the heat and let it simmer for about 20 minutes, or until the celeriac is tender.
-
Blend the Soup: Once the celeriac is softened, use an immersion blender to puree the soup until smooth (or transfer to a stand blender in batches). Stir in the heavy cream and season with salt and pepper.
-
Prepare the Crispy Kale: While your soup simmers,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Toss the kale with a little olive oil, salt, and pepper on a baking sheet. Bake for about 10-15 minutes until crispy.
-
Serve: Ladle the warm soup into bowls, top generously with crispy kale, and enjoy!
Tip: If you prefer a thicker soup, reduce the amount of broth, or feel free to add an extra potato for creaminess.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
As with any recipe, a few missteps can affect the outcome. Common mistakes include:
- Under-seasoning: Don’t forget to season each layer; it’s crucial for a flavorful soup.
- Overcooking the Kale: Keep an eye on your kale in the oven to avoid burning. The goal is crispness, not char.
- Skipping the Blending: If you leave the soup chunky, you’ll miss out on that smooth, rich texture.

Can I use dried garlic instead of fresh?
Yes, dried garlic is a suitable alternative, although fresh garlic offers a more pronounced flavor. If using dried, start with less, as it’s more concentrated.
How do I store leftover Celeriac and Brown Butter Soup with Crispy Kale?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ove, adding a splash of broth if it thickens.
Can I freeze Celeriac and Brown Butter Soup with Crispy Kale?
Absolutely! This soup freezes well. Let it cool completely before transferring to freezer-safe containers. It can be frozen for up to 3 months.
